Browser only - 100% private

Image to Favicon Generator

Turn any image into a complete favicon set in your browser. ICO, PNG, Apple touch icon, Android Chrome icons, manifest, and an HTML snippet - bundled as a ZIP.

Instant preview Privacy-first No signup

Upload a square (or any) image to generate a favicon set.

PNG, JPG, WEBP, AVIF, GIF, and SVG are accepted. Use a logo of at least 512x512 for the sharpest results. The file never leaves your device.

Image to Favicon online with ImgShifter

Every site needs a favicon and every favicon generator on the web wants the same thing: upload your logo. ImgShifter's generator runs entirely in your browser instead - the image is read with the File API, resized with the Canvas API, packaged with JSZip, and handed back to you as a ZIP. No upload, no signup, no watermark, and the page keeps working with the network disconnected.

The output is the modern minimum that covers every browser shipped in the last decade: favicon.ico with embedded 16/32/48 PNG frames for legacy callers and pinned tabs, explicit favicon-16x16.png and favicon-32x32.png for browsers that prefer PNG, apple-touch-icon.png at 180x180 (with a background color applied so iOS Safari doesn't composite onto black), android-chrome-192x192.png and android-chrome-512x512.png referenced from a PWA-ready site.webmanifest, and a paste-ready HTML snippet with all the <link> tags.

Source images of 512x512 or larger give the sharpest result. Non-square sources are handled by the embedded square cropper - pick the region you want and the same crop is used for every export size. SVG inputs rasterize crisply at every dimension because they have no fixed resolution. Drop the ZIP into your site's root, paste the snippet into the <head>, and hard-refresh once - browsers cache favicons aggressively.

Other ImgShifter tools people use alongside Image to Favicon.

Frequently asked questions

Short answers for image workflows, privacy, and supported formats.